Just a question aanns13. They did not mention that they will send my PR Card on my address. Are we going to apply for PR card? Or does the carway officers will do that for us,? kinda weird cos they did not get my address info, all they got is my workpermit and passport, COPR it doesn't state there my address. To my excitement on doing my PR landing i forgot to ask this question on the visa officer. Anyone got an idea? Thanks have a blessed day

They told me my PR card will be sent to my address but they did not take my address. So I called CIC (select option that says Permamnent Residence Card) and check my address on file. They usually use the same address they send your passport. But for mental peace, you can call and confirm your address is correct.
 
Also, when I called, they told me that the processing time of PR card is changing randomly. Currently, the processing time of PR card is roughly 33 days. So We should get our PR card within a month or so I believe.
